Rounding corners on paper is easily done using a specialized tool called a corner punch.
Using a corner punch allows you to quickly and uniformly round the edges of your paper. The process typically involves preparing the tool, inserting the paper, and activating the punch.
Steps for Rounding Paper Corners with a Punch
Based on the provided information, here's how to round corners using this specific type of punch:
- Prepare the Punch: This particular type of corner punch is designed for easy storage. It has two flaps that close. To use it, you simply open out the two flaps that were closed for storage.
- Insert Paper Corner: Take the piece of paper you want to round the corner of. Insert one corner of the paper directly into the punch opening.
- Punch the Corner: Once the paper corner is properly inserted, you would then perform the punching action (though the reference focuses on preparation and insertion, this is the next logical step with a punch). The punch mechanism cuts the corner into a rounded shape.
- Repeat for Other Corners: If you wish to round multiple corners on the same piece of paper, remove the paper, rotate it, and repeat steps 2 and 3 for each desired corner.
